Boutique hotel coming to Waterloo

Lambeth Council has approved plans for a 66-bedroom boutique hotel and shops near Waterloo Station at 100-108 Lower Marsh Road, SE1.

The existing parade of shops will be turned into six shops covering 6,900 sq ft in total and a 24,339 sq ft hotel.

The site will be developed by Max Barney and is owned by the Bard family, which owns property across London.

BC Retail is advising on both the retail and hotel element of the scheme, which is scheduled for completion in summer 2019.
